Common use of Duplication of Coverage Clause in Contracts

Duplication of Coverage. Where more than one (1) member of a household is employed by the Board, only one (1) family policy or two (2) single policies shall be provided. Provided, however, that each employee shall receive life insurance coverage regardless of whether other family members are employed by the Board. Employees affected by this provision shall notify the Treasurer which family member is to be enrolled in the family plan.
